Role Overview
Join a prominent, privately owned multidisciplinary design consultancy based in London SE1 as an Associate Structural Engineer. This role offers a hands-on position within the structures team, focusing on a diverse portfolio of building designs including high-end residential, complex mixed-use developments, multinational retail clients, hotel chains, and transport projects with values ranging from 100,000 to 45 million.
Work Environment and Benefits
The office is conveniently located near overground rail and tube stations, featuring excellent workspace. Employees enjoy a competitive pension scheme, life assurance, a loyalty bonus, health plans, an additional day of bank holiday, and a supportive social environment with various benefits.
Training and Career Progression
The firm emphasizes a hands-on approach and supports continuous professional development. Employees are encouraged and assisted in obtaining Chartered status if not already accredited. The company supports training initiatives and offers strong future promotional opportunities for motivated individuals.
Candidate Profile
Ideal candidates are ambitious, flexible, and skilled all-around designers with several years of UK structural design experience on larger building schemes. They should be capable of taking a senior leadership role in a fast-paced office environment and seeking to enhance their careers.
